An interactive poll on the front page of the CNN website in October 2011 asked if readers would consider voting for Herman Cain, who at the time, was a Republican presidential candidate. A statistics student used the information from the poll to calculate the 95 % confidence interval. He got ( 0.53 , 0.59 ) . He also conducted a hypothesis test. He found very strong evidence that more than half of voters would consider voting for Herman Cain.
